Experience Les Claypool's Unique Bassistry and Visionary Sound
Les Claypool is not merely a musician; he is an institution, a mad scientist of sound whose influence stretches across multiple genres. Best known as the driving force behind the iconic band Primus, Claypool has forged a distinctive path with his virtuosic bass playing, which combines slap bass, tapping, flamenco-like strumming, and a host of unconventional techniques to create melodies, rhythms, and textures simultaneously. His lyrical storytelling is equally unique, often weaving surreal narratives populated by idiosyncratic characters. Beyond Primus, Claypool’s expansive career includes a myriad of acclaimed projects such as Oysterhead (with Trey Anastasio and Stewart Copeland), The Les Claypool’s Flying Frog Brigade, and the Fancy Band, each showcasing different facets of his boundless creativity. Toyota Music Factory - Your Premier Entertainment Destination in Irving, TX
The Pavilion at Toyota Music Factory stands as a jewel in the crown of Irving, Texas’s entertainment landscape, offering a state-of-the-art venue designed to provide an unparalleled concert experience. Located in the vibrant Las Colinas urban center, The Pavilion is a versatile, covered outdoor amphitheater that can transform to accommodate various capacities, ensuring an intimate yet expansive feel for every event, including the highly anticipated Les Claypool show on June 25, 2026. Its modern architecture and excellent acoustics are specifically engineered to enhance live music performances, making it an ideal setting for an artist as sonically intricate as Claypool. Navigating The Pavilion Experience at Toyota Music Factory in Irving
Attending a concert at The Pavilion at Toyota Music Factory offers a seamless and enjoyable experience, meticulously planned to ensure every guest has a fantastic time, especially when seeing an artist of Les Claypool’s caliber. Located conveniently in Irving, TX, the venue is easily accessible from major highways and is also serviced by Dallas Area Rapid Transit (DART), with the Las Colinas Urban Center Station just a short walk away. For those driving to see Les Claypool on June 25, 2026, ample parking is available within the Toyota Music Factory complex and surrounding areas, including structured garages that offer convenient access to The Pavilion.
